Trick or tip I got from reading on the Bass Barn:

This goes for non-frozen fish fillets. I haven't tried it with freshwater fish.

DO NOT WASH OR RINSE YOUR SALTWATER FISH FILLETS!!

That's right, do not wash or rinse the fillets especially with fresh water. You might ask, what if its bloody? Take the knife and scrape the blood off or even use a paper towel if you have to. I've been doing this for a year now and I've noticed my fish tasting better (may be in my head??). Rinse your knife and cleaning surface, not your fillets.

Would any true steak lover rinse a big bloody ribeye before grilling it? I know I WOULDN'T!! 8)

Try it, you'll agree....
